An In-Depth Review of the Lan Ha Bay Boutique Cruise
The Itinerary: What to Expect
This two-day adventure kicks off early with hotel pickup in Hanoi’s Old Quarter or near the Opera House. From there, the journey to Cat Ba Island’s Cai Beo Harbour takes about 2.5 hours, setting the stage for a day packed with activities and scenic views.
Day 1 begins around noon when you’ll check in onboard the cruise. The boat departs to cruise through Lan Ha Bay, known for its striking limestone karsts and calm waters. While sailing, you’re treated to a special Vietnamese seafood lunch, a delightful way to start the trip, as one reviewer noted. The pleasure of eating fresh, flavorful dishes while watching the islands glide by makes for a memorable meal.
In the afternoon, kayaking around Lan Ha Bay is a major highlight. The included kayaking gear makes it accessible for most, and the experience of paddling amid towering limestone formations is often described as peaceful and invigorating. As one reviewer shared, they loved the “wonderful kayaking” and appreciated guides who made the activity safe and enjoyable.
Later, you’ll have the chance to swim right off the boat — a favorite among travelers. One guest described jumping from the top deck into the clear waters as a “highlight,” emphasizing how accessible and fun swimming here can be. The evening features a Vietnamese cooking class preparing spring rolls, which is both practical and tasty, as visitors often say it enhances their connection to local cuisine.
Dinner is served onboard, with generous, well-prepared local dishes. Afterward, guests can fish for squid, sing karaoke, or simply relax under the stars. The happy hour on the sun deck offers a casual setting for socializing, rounding out a lively first day.
Day 2 begins with a peaceful sunrise view (or at least the hope of one, depending on the season). A hearty breakfast fuels your day of exploration. The day includes a bike ride to Viet Hai Village, a scenic half-hour ride that gives you a glimpse into rural life. Reviewers loved this aspect, with one describing the scenery as “very pretty,” and the guide making the experience enjoyable despite potential rain.
Later, lunch onboard provides a chance to refuel before heading back to Beo Harbor for disembarkation and the trip back to Hanoi. The entire experience is approximately 15 hours on the first day, with additional time for transfers and activities.

Practical Details and Value
Pricing at $140 per person covers most activities and meals, making this a solid value for what’s included. The fact that all entrance fees and kayaking gear are provided removes extra hassle and cost, and the comfortable cabins mean you don’t have to camp or rough it. Plus, optional airport/hotel pick-up makes organizing logistics easier.
For those concerned about costs, it’s worth noting the additional fees for holiday surcharges (e.g., $30 on December 24/31 and Lunar New Year), which are clearly communicated and payable locally.
Transportation from Hanoi is flexible, with options for hotel pickup, and the entire experience is designed to be accessible and easy to join, with clear instructions on meeting points and bookings.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Is transportation from Hanoi included?
Yes, the tour offers hotel transfers in Hanoi, with options for pickup from the Old Quarter or Hanoi Opera House. Additional arrangements are available for different locations.
What should I bring?
Travelers should pack essentials like an umbrella or hat, sun protection (sunscreen, sunglasses), comfortable shoes or sandals, swimwear and towels, small cash, water bottles, snacks, raincoats if needed, insect spray, and warm clothing for winter.
Are meals included?
Yes, the tour includes two breakfasts, two lunches, and one dinner onboard, with the food praised for being plentiful and delicious.
What activities are part of the tour?
Kayaking, swimming, cycling, hiking, cooking classes, squid fishing, and sightseeing in local villages are included, with all gear provided.
Is this tour suitable for families or solo travelers?
With a maximum group size of 25, it’s a good option for solo travelers seeking a small-group experience. Families with active kids may enjoy the outdoor pursuits, but younger children might find the schedule demanding.
What are the accommodation options?
Guests sleep in air-conditioned cabins with private bathrooms onboard the boat, offering a comfortable night’s rest amidst stunning scenery.
Can I cancel for a refund?
Yes, cancellations made at least 24 hours in advance are fully refundable. Cancellations closer to the date may not be, so plan accordingly.
